Ralf Corsepius wrote:
> As a developer, maintainer and/or packager you normally want to see what
> the tools are doing, e.g. if the compiler has received the correct
> flags, is using the correct libraries etc.

Sure, but I care about that once in a great while. The rest of the time, 
I really have no objection to the terse output cmake generates by 
default. (Remember you *can* get the full output, either by 'make 
VERBOSE=1' or you can ask cmake to just generate verbose makefiles.)

Of course, I like my percentage progress (a LOT, in big projects) also. 
Maybe because I actually watch what my builds are doing as opposed to 
*only* inspecting the log when it finishes. Plus, I challenge you to 
argue that it isn't friendlier for casual end-users :-).
